Message type: E = Error
Message class: PROD_CONF_MSGS -
Message number: 002
Message text: Orderid : &1 is neither a process or a production order

- Orderid : &1 is neither a process or a production order ?The SAP error message
PROD_CONF_MSGS002
indicates that the order ID specified (represented by&1
) is neither recognized as a process order nor as a production order. This error typically arises in the context of production planning and execution within SAP, particularly when trying to confirm production orders or process orders.Causes:
- Incorrect Order Type: The order ID you are trying to process may not be a valid production or process order. It could be a different type of order (e.g., maintenance order, sales order, etc.).
- Order Deletion or Incompletion: The order may have been deleted or is in an incomplete state, making it unavailable for confirmation.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access or confirm the specified order.
- Data Entry Error: There might be a typographical error in the order ID entered, leading to the system not recognizing it.
- System Configuration: There could be issues with the configuration of the order types in the system.
Solutions:
- Verify Order ID: Double-check the order ID you are trying to confirm. Ensure that it is correctly entered and corresponds to a valid production or process order.
- Check Order Status: Use transaction codes like
CO03
(Display Production Order) orC223
(Display Process Order) to check the status of the order. Ensure it is not deleted or in an incomplete state.- Review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access and confirm the order. This may require coordination with your SAP security team.
- Consult with SAP Support: If the issue persists, it may be beneficial to consult with your SAP support team or refer to SAP Notes for any known issues related to this error message.
- Check Configuration: If you have access to configuration settings, verify that the order types are correctly set up in the system.
